传感器网络能源有效任务分配算法  被引量:5

An Energy-Efficient Task Assignment Algorithm of Wireless Sensor Network

在线阅读下载全文

作  者:李志刚[1] 周兴社[1] 李士宁[1] 马峻岩[1] 

机构地区:[1]西北工业大学计算机学院,西安710072

出  处:《计算机研究与发展》2009年第12期1994-2002,共9页Journal of Computer Research and Development

基  金:国家自然科学基金项目(60573161);国家科技支撑计划基金项目(2007BAD79B0);陕西省自然科学基金项目(SJ08-2T06)~~

摘  要:为了延长网络生命期,传感器网络在设计过程中,通常利用节点本身的处理能力,进行网内处理,以减少通信量,节省能量.在传感器网络内引入处理或计算后,应用可以描述为一个任务集及任务之间的数据依赖关系.不同的任务分配方案导致应用执行所需的通信量和计算量不同,从而影响应用执行的能量消耗.在使用任务图对传感器网络应用描述的基础上,提出了传感器网络任务分配模型.由于应用的任务可划分为感知任务集和处理任务集,因而传感器网络中的任务分配可分成感知任务分配和处理任务分配两个阶段.针对处理任务分配,将其建模为二次0-1规划问题,并提出了分布式逐层优化分配算法OALL.仿真实验验证了分布式算法OALL的有效性.In-network processing methods are often adopted in wireless sensor network (WSN) to reduce data communication and prolong the lifetime of network, which enables a WSN application to be described as a set of tasks (sensing, processing) and dependencies among them. Task assignment has become an important problem which needs to be resolved, as different task assignments can cause different communication traffics, and then cause different energy consumption when performing the application. Based on the task graph of WSN described by DAG (direeted aeyelic graph), an energy- efficient task assignment framework is proposed. As an application can be decomposed into sensing tasks and processing tasks, the task assignment is presented as a process of sensing task assignment and processing task assignment. Sensing task assignment involves sensor selection in WSN and some work has been done for this problem. In this paper, the authors consider the problem of how to assign the processing tasks after the selection of sensors to make the application performed using minimum energy. The processing task assignment is formulated as a quadratic 0-1 programming problem, and a distributed OALL algorithm (optimizing assignment layer by layer) is proposed. With demonstrative example, the proposed algorithm has been evaluated, and the results of experiment has proved its effectiveness.

关 键 词:无线传感器网络 任务图 任务分配 二次0-1规划 分布式算法 

分 类 号:TP393[自动化与计算机技术—计算机应用技术]

 

参考文献:

正在载入数据...

 

二级参考文献:

正在载入数据...

 

耦合文献:

正在载入数据...

 

引证文献:

正在载入数据...

 

二级引证文献:

正在载入数据...

 

同被引文献:

正在载入数据...

 

相关期刊文献:

正在载入数据...

相关的主题
相关的作者对象
相关的机构对象